What is reasoning? someone help me out
GrogVix [38]

Answer:

Reasoning is the action of thinking about something in a logical, sensible way.

It's often the influence of people's actions. Reasoning can be in your own thoughts, though reasoning may be more obvious. Example of Reasoning:

1- There is a door that leads into a room with fire, and there is a door that leads to the safe outdoors. They chose to go outdoors. Reasoning: The door outside is the safest, easiest option.

2- You have to complete cooking a dinner in 5 hours. You can begin making every course of the meal at once, or you can finish each one at a time. You choose to go step by step. Reasoning: You know doing it all at once will be too stressful, and it would be more efficient to finish each one at a set pace.
